GBAYC6100066 is the International Standard Recording Code (ISRC) for the recording “Concerto for Violin and Orchestra No. 3 in G major, K. 216 "Strassburg": II. Adagio” by Yehudi Menuhin, Bath Festival Orchestra, Menuhin Festival Orchestra, released 1991-01-01. ISRCs are 12-character ISO 3901 identifiers that uniquely tag a specific sound recording — different masters, remixes, and live versions each receive a distinct ISRC.
